yydg.net
当前位置:首页 >> 元素水平居中 >>

元素水平居中

水平居中有两种情况:子元素,父级元素都是块级元素的时候,子级元素{margin:0 auto}.需要注意的是当子级元素的position为非默认及relative时,这种设置会失效.如p等标签中内的文字内容水平居中:使用{text-Align:center}.垂直居中设置该元素的行高等于元素的高.如:{height:100px;line-height:100px}可实现.注意:这种方法应用于行内元素

先把外层的相对定位的大div用margin:0px auto;居中,然后这个绝对定位的用left多少像素(或百分比)或者top多少像素(或百分比)来定位.

你的内容是什么呢,如果是文字,可以用行高.比如div的高度是20,就设置个line-height:20px;希望可以帮到您,望采纳

margin-top为负值不会增加高度,只会产生向上位移margin-bottom为负值不会产生位移,会减少自身的供css读取的高度

用top:50%,再margin-top:负元素本身高度的一半就是中间位置了,,

如果被设置元素为文本、图片等行内元素时,水平居中是通过给父元素设置 text-align:center 来实现的.当被设置元素为块状元素时通过设置“左右margin”值为“auto”来实现居中的.

div实现水平居中只需要设置固定宽度和margin:0 auto即可, 给你2个解决方案: 1、条件是div的高度和宽度是固定的 让层垂直居中 其实解决的思路是这样的:首们需要position:absolute;绝对定位.而层的定位点,使用外补丁margin负值的方

DIV水平垂直居中显示:将left和top设置为50%来定位div到浏览器中央,再将margin-left和margin-top值设置为宽和高的一半,使div居中显示.如果是让一个块里面的内容垂直水平居中的话就很简单了,设置父元素的text-align:center;line-height

1 主要的核心思想就是给div设置margin:0 auto ,这样就能居中 . 2 下面是实现 div块级元素水平居中 的代码 :(在下面的代码 我的div 宽度200px 高度40px 背景颜色是蓝色 文字水平居中) 其实没什么特别好解释的 就是一个样式,是因为百度

* { margin-right: auto; margin-left: auto; } 这个是代码, 在CSS里面做, 我的网站http://www.gottt.com 全是DIV做的 你可以下载下来看一下CSS

网站首页 | 网站地图
All rights reserved Powered by www.yydg.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com